How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Scio?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Scio Studio Apartments | $739 | $675 | $900 |
| Scio 1 Bedroom Apartments | $975 | $400 | $1,715 |
| Scio 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,067 | $550 | $2,474 |
| Scio 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,126 | $445 | $1,615 |
| Scio 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,155 | $1,155 | $1,155 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Scio?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$959 | $600 | $2,300 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$1,141 | $850 | $1,700 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$2,000 | $2,000 | $2,000 |
